Waterville, Maine - The Colby Men's Basketball team is set to being the new season this Saturday heading to Nashua, N.H. to face the Rivier University Raiders. The Mules are under new leadership this season in
Sean Rutigliano, the Richard L. Whitmore Jr. Head Coach for Colby Men's Basketball.
"We're really excited about this group, stated Rutigliano. "The closeness and brotherhood within our team have stood out from day one. All 18 guys represent Colby and our program the right way, on and off the court. I'm very happy with our three team captains and the leadership they've brought to the group. Our five first-years have done a tremendous job adjusting to the speed and physicality of the college game, and they've integrated seamlessly with our returners. As a team, we're continuing to emphasize growth on the defensive end, strengthening our chemistry, and continuing to focus on player development both on and off the court. We can't wait to open the season against Rivier University and finally have the chance to compete against someone else."
The Mules ended the 2024-25 season with a 13-12 overall record falling to Trinity in the NESCAC Quarterfinals. This year the team will be led by a trio of seniors;
Max Poulton,
Rashard Doyal, and
Miles Drake who are looking to improve on last years result.
Poulton, who hit the 1,000 point mark last season, has been a key offensive threat for the Mules the past few years. The two-time All-Conference selection started in all 25 games last season totaling 369 points (14.8 per game), the eighth most points in the conference. The guard also contributed 118 rebounds, 70 assists (10th most in the NESCAC), 30 steals and 10 blocks over the course of the 25 games. Other key returners who hit the 200-point mark last year include
Marcos Montiel (285 points),
Sam Hinman (249 points) and
Dan Civello (229 points). Montiel led the team is assists (83) last season while having the second most minutes played (710), only behind Poulton (793). On the defensive end Civello led the team in blocks with 36.
Rutigliano is joined by two new assistant coaches. The John "Swisher" Mitchell Assistant Coach for Colby Men's Basketball
Ryan Jenei, who comes to Mayflower Hill after serving as an Assistant Coach for Oglethorpe University from 2023-25 and
Benji Oxman who also comes from Oglethorpe University as an Assistant Coach.
